V-set and immunoglobulin domain containing 4 (Vsig4) is a membrane protein belonging to complement receptor of the immunoglobulin superfamily. Vsig4 may be a negative regulator of T-cell responses and interleukin-2 production, Vsig4 also mediates clearance of C3b opsonized pathogens by binding C3b. The expression of VSIG4 is restricted to tissue macrophages where Vsig4 inhibits proinflammatory macrophage activation by reprogramming mitochondrial pyruvate metabolism. VSIG4 Protein, Mouse (HEK293, His-Fc) is the recombinant mouse-derived VSIG4 protein, expressed by HEK293 , with C-hFc, C-His labeled tag.
Molecular Weight:
Approximately 60 kDa,based on S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ions,due to the glycosylation.
